N2 - Based on the traditional miniaturized planar Archimedean spiral antenna, a conical conformal Archimedean antenna is discussed. For the planar Archimedean spiral antenna, the spiral lines nearby the feed point is the traditional Archimedean spiral line and the outer curves on the antenna aperture are the zigzag curves, which is in order to miniaturize the antenna. The planar Archimedean spiral antenna is projected onto the surface of a dielectric cone and the miniaturized conical conformal Archimedean spiral antenna is formed. A specific antenna model is simulated and the simulation results reveal that the simulated antenna has still ultra wide band (UWB) performance, but its performances degrade compared to the corresponding planar Archimedean spiral antenna. For the working frequency range from 2GHz to 12GHz, the antenna has steady impedance and the gain is more than 0dBi. But the antenna patterns fluctuate with frequency notably. The discussed antenna has the UWB and conformal characteristics and can be applied in some UWB systems to meet some special requirement.
